Americo Henriques

November 15, 1920 - February 10, 2006

Americo "Mickey" or "Mac" Henriques, 85, of Fairhaven died Friday, February 10, 2006 at Alden Court Nursing and Rehabilitation Center after a period of declining health. He was the widower of the late Priscilla (LaCroix) Henriques and the husband of Janice I. (Johnsen) Henriques. They would have celebrated 33 years of marriage.

Born November 15, 1920 in New Bedford the son of the late Francisco and Olympia (Cabral) Henriques, he lived in New Bedford until moving to Fairhaven in 1953.
Mr. Henriques graduated from New Bedford High School with the Class of 1939. He served in the Army during World War II. He worked as a sales man for Hathaway Bakery in New Bedford and then later was an Insurance Agent for John Hancock Insurance for 25 years.

He was an accomplished golfer and former member of the Whaling City Golf Club and Reservation Country Club. He was a former Whaling City Fourball Champion, a member of the Fairhaven Varsity Club, and a member of the Andrew Dahill VFW Post of New Bedford. Mr. Henriques was and avid sports fan and loved watching all the local New England teams.

He loved his family and especially loved spending time with his grandchildren and great grand children.
